The global smart infrastructure market is experiencing rapid growth, driven by increasing urbanization and adoption of advanced digital technologies. The market was valued at USD 232.11 billion in 2025 and is projected to grow to USD 286.67 billion in 2026, reaching USD 681.85 billion by 2034, exhibiting a strong CAGR of 11.44% during the forecast period (2026-2034).
North America dominated the market in 2025, accounting for a significant 79.22% share, supported by rapid technological adoption and strong infrastructure investments.
Smart infrastructure integrates information and communication technology (ICT), Internet of Things (IoT), and data analytics into physical infrastructure systems such as transportation, energy, water networks, and buildings. These systems enhance efficiency, sustainability, and real-time decision-making capabilities.
Market Trends
Advancements in Smart Grid Technology
One of the major trends shaping the market is the rapid development of smart grid technologies. These systems integrate digital communication with power grids to optimize electricity distribution, reduce energy losses, and enhance sustainability.
Smart grids enable real-time monitoring, intelligent energy distribution, and efficient load management. The integration of renewable energy sources and energy storage systems further strengthens their role in modern infrastructure development.
Market Growth Factors
Rising Implementation of Telecommunication Networks
The expansion of telecommunication infrastructure is a major driver for smart infrastructure development. Technologies such as IoT, wireless sensor networks, and cloud computing play a crucial role in enabling efficient communication and data exchange within smart cities.
The deployment of 5G networks is further accelerating smart city initiatives by improving connectivity and enabling advanced applications such as real-time traffic management and remote monitoring systems.
Increasing Focus on Sustainability and Green Energy
Governments and industries worldwide are focusing on reducing carbon emissions and achieving sustainability goals. Smart infrastructure supports these objectives by optimizing energy usage, reducing waste, and improving operational efficiency.
The integration of renewable energy solutions, smart buildings, and intelligent transportation systems is contributing significantly to environmental sustainability and resource conservation.
Restraining Factors
Cybersecurity and Privacy Concerns
Despite its advantages, the smart infrastructure market faces challenges related to data security and privacy. The extensive use of IoT devices and data exchange increases vulnerability to cyber threats.
Lack of standardized security frameworks and policies further complicates the issue, making it difficult to ensure secure data transmission across interconnected systems. Cyberattacks on infrastructure systems can disrupt operations and pose significant risks to public safety.

Competitive Landscape
The market is highly competitive, with key players focusing on innovation, partnerships, and expansion strategies. Major companies include Siemens, Schneider Electric, Philips, Indra, Sensus, and Aclara.
These companies are investing in smart technologies such as digital twins, IoT-enabled systems, and energy-efficient solutions to strengthen their market position and expand their global footprint.
